Storm window installation services involve the placement of additional windows designed to be installed over existing window frames. This process typically includes measuring the current windows, selecting appropriate storm window styles, and securely attaching the units to enhance the home's exterior. The goal is to improve insulation, reduce drafts, and provide extra protection against harsh weather conditions. Professionals ensure that the storm windows are properly fitted to prevent air leaks and water intrusion, contributing to a more energy-efficient and comfortable indoor environment.

These services address common problems such as drafts, air leaks, and condensation that can occur around standard windows, especially during colder months. Storm windows act as a barrier, helping to retain heat inside and prevent cold air from seeping in. They also protect the primary windows from damage caused by wind, hail, or debris, which can prolong the lifespan of existing window units. Installing storm windows can result in noticeable energy savings and a reduction in heating and cooling costs over time.

Properties that typically utilize storm window installation services include residential homes, especially older houses with single-pane or outdated windows. Commercial buildings, including retail stores and office spaces, may also benefit from storm windows to enhance insulation and protect storefronts. Additionally, properties in regions with severe winter weather or frequent storms often seek professional installation to ensure their windows are adequately shielded against the elements. Material Costs - The cost of materials for storm window installation typically ranges from $50 to $200 per window, depending on size and type. For example, standard aluminum storm windows may cost around $75 each, while custom or premium options can be higher.

Labor Expenses - Labor fees for installing storm windows generally fall between $100 and $300 per window. Factors influencing cost include window size, number of units, and complexity of installation in Granby, CO area homes.

Additional Charges - Some service providers may charge extra for removal of old windows or special framing adjustments, which can add $50 to $150 per window. These costs vary based on the specific requirements of the installation site.

Overall Project Cost - The total cost for installing storm windows in a typical home can range from $400 to $2,000, depending on the number of windows and selected materials.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on individual project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m windows? Storm windows are additional window panels installed on the exterior or interior of existing windows to provide extra insulation and protection against weather elements.

How do storm window installations benefit my home? Installing storm windows can improve energy efficiency, reduce drafts, and help protect your primary windows from damage caused by harsh weather.

Who should I contact for storm window installation services? Homeowners interested in storm window installation can reach out to local service providers or contractors experienced in window enhancements.

Are storm windows suitable for all types of windows? Storm windows are available in various styles to fit different window types, but it’s best to consult with a local professional to determine compatibility.

What should I consider before installing storm windows? It’s important to evaluate your current windows, your climate, and consult with local pros to select the right storm window options for your home.
